Deed of Lease Seventh Edition 2024: Your Questions Answered 2025 (On Demand)

This On Demand was recorded on 16 June 2025.

The seventh edition of the Deed of Lease has been in use since November. Further to the webinar which accompanied the release, this On Demand  will address questions in relation to use of the Deed of Lease which have arisen in this period. The session will also introduce other refreshed documents in the suite, including the Deed of Assignment, Deed of Sublease and Agreement to Lease. 

Take advantage of this opportunity to gain further insights into working with the Deed of Lease and other associated documents. 

Learning Outcomes

  • Benefit from an extensive question-and-answer session reflecting real-life experience of using the Deed of Lease Seventh Edition 2024 over 7 months.
  • Become more familiar with the changes to other documents in the lease suite, including the Deed of Assignment, Deed of Sublease and Agreement to Lease

Who Should Watch?

All property lawyers, property litigators and legal executives. Commercial real estate agents and property managers would also find this session useful.

Justin March

Justin March is the head of DLA Piper’s real estate practice in New Zealand with over 30 years' experience.

He regularly advises leading domestic and global corporates which operate across multiple jurisdictions on a broad range of industry sectors and asset classes. Justin advises on large scale commercial property, infrastructure and development projects. He is consistently ranked as a leading partner by Legal 500 and Chambers & Partners and was inducted in the NZLS Property Law Section Hall of Fame.

Joanna Pidgeon

Joanna is a property law expert, Past President of ADLS (TLANZ), Convenor of TLANZ’s Documents & Precedents Committee and a member of its Property Law Committee. She is also a member of NZLS’ Land Titles Committee. She often makes determinations under the ASPRE when there are disputes, is a past Chair of the Property Disputes Committee and gives expert evidence in Courts and Tribunals on a wide range of property matters.

Tony Herring

Tony joined the Wellington office of Gibson Sheat as a partner in March 2021, after 24 years with Mortlock McCormack Law in Christchurch. He practises in the areas of commercial and property law, with an emphasis on Crown property work, commercial leasing, and employment law. Tony was appointed as a Notary Public in 2009.
